11–13 Dec 2025
Asia/Tokyo timezone

Tyr: a new Rust GPU driver

Not scheduled
20m
Rust MC Rust MC

Speakers

Mrs Alice Ryhl (Google) Daniel Almeida (Collabora)

Description

Showcase the current state of Tyr, a new Rust kernel driver for Arm Mali GPUs, briefly mentioning current status of the driver and the associated Rust abstractions needed to support it, as well as the future plans for both upstream and Android.

The discussion should be centered on whether the current upstreaming plan makes sense to the DRM community, considering our efforts both upstream and downstream. We also aim to discuss how to combine efforts with the current JobQueue abstraction that is being worked on. This includes possibly using the downstream Tyr branch as a testbed for the design, as well as discussing in what other ways the Tyr team can contribute to this work.

Primary author

Daniel Almeida (Collabora)

Co-author

Mrs Alice Ryhl (Google)

Presentation materials

There are no materials yet.